手机搜索引擎数据库是什么
-
手机搜索引擎数据库是一个存储和管理网页信息的数据库。它包含了互联网上几乎所有的网页内容,以便用户在使用手机搜索引擎时能够快速找到他们需要的信息。手机搜索引擎数据库的主要功能是通过网页爬虫程序来自动收集和索引互联网上的网页内容,然后将这些内容存储在数据库中,以便用户进行搜索。
以下是关于手机搜索引擎数据库的五个重要点:
-
数据收集:手机搜索引擎数据库通过使用网络爬虫程序来收集互联网上的网页内容。这些爬虫程序会按照一定的规则和算法,自动地访问网页并将其内容下载到数据库中。爬虫程序会遵循网页的链接,以便能够尽可能地收集更多的网页内容。
-
数据索引:手机搜索引擎数据库将收集到的网页内容进行索引,以便用户在进行搜索时能够快速找到他们需要的信息。索引是一种将网页内容关联到特定关键词或短语的方法,它可以提高搜索的效率和准确性。索引通常是按照关键词的频率、位置和重要性等因素进行排序的。
-
数据存储:手机搜索引擎数据库使用分布式存储系统来存储收集到的网页内容。这种存储系统通常由多个服务器组成,每个服务器都保存部分网页内容的副本。这样可以提高数据的可靠性和可用性,并且能够更好地处理大量的数据。
-
数据更新:手机搜索引擎数据库需要定期更新,以保持数据库中的内容与互联网上的网页内容保持同步。更新通常包括收集新的网页内容、更新已有网页的索引以及删除已经不存在的网页等操作。数据更新的频率取决于数据库的规模和互联网上网页内容的变化速度。
-
数据质量控制:手机搜索引擎数据库需要对收集到的网页内容进行质量控制,以保证搜索结果的准确性和可靠性。质量控制包括对网页内容的去重、过滤低质量的网页、检测和处理垃圾信息等操作。这些操作能够提高搜索的质量,并且减少垃圾信息对用户的干扰。
综上所述,手机搜索引擎数据库是一个存储和管理互联网上网页内容的数据库。它通过收集、索引、存储、更新和质量控制等操作,为用户提供快速、准确的搜索结果。
1年前 -
-
手机搜索引擎数据库是用于存储和管理搜索引擎索引的数据库。搜索引擎数据库包含了互联网上的各种网页、图片、视频等资源的索引信息,以便用户在搜索时能够快速找到相关内容。
手机搜索引擎数据库主要由以下几个组成部分:
-
网页爬取器(Crawler):搜索引擎会使用爬虫程序定期访问互联网上的各个网站,将网页内容抓取到数据库中。爬取器会按照一定的规则遍历网页,获取网页的URL、标题、内容等信息。
-
索引器(Indexer):索引器是搜索引擎的核心部分,它将爬取到的网页内容进行处理和分析,提取关键词并建立索引。索引是一个包含关键词、网页URL和相关信息的数据结构,用于加快搜索速度和提高搜索结果的准确性。
-
检索器(Retriever):当用户在手机上输入搜索关键词时,搜索引擎会将关键词与数据库中的索引进行匹配。检索器会根据匹配程度和相关性对索引进行排序,然后返回给用户相应的搜索结果。
-
排名算法(Ranking Algorithm):搜索引擎还会根据一些算法对搜索结果进行排序,以确保用户能够看到最相关和最有质量的内容。排名算法会考虑多个因素,如关键词的出现频率、网页的权威性和用户的点击行为等。
-
数据库管理系统(DBMS):搜索引擎数据库需要使用数据库管理系统进行数据的存储和管理。常见的数据库管理系统包括MySQL、Oracle等。
手机搜索引擎数据库的设计和优化是搜索引擎公司的核心竞争力之一。通过不断优化数据库结构、提高索引和检索算法的效率,搜索引擎可以提供更快速、准确和有用的搜索结果,满足用户的需求。
1年前 -
-
手机搜索引擎数据库是指存储和管理手机搜索引擎所需的数据的系统。它包括索引数据库、网页数据库、图片数据库、视频数据库等多个模块,用于存储和管理各类网页内容、图片、视频等信息。手机搜索引擎数据库的设计和优化对于提高搜索引擎的搜索速度和准确性非常重要。
手机搜索引擎数据库的构建和维护主要包括以下几个方面的工作:
-
数据采集:搜索引擎通过网络爬虫程序定期抓取互联网上的网页内容,并将抓取到的数据存储到数据库中。爬虫程序会根据一定的策略和规则,遍历网页链接,逐个抓取网页内容,包括网页的文本、URL、标题、关键词等信息。
-
数据预处理:为了提高搜索引擎的搜索效果,需要对抓取到的数据进行预处理。预处理包括去除HTML标签、提取关键词、分词等操作。分词是将网页的文本内容按照一定的规则切分成词语的过程,这样可以提高搜索引擎对用户查询的理解能力。
-
数据索引:索引是搜索引擎数据库的核心部分,它是一种快速查找数据的数据结构。索引的建立需要对数据进行分析和整理,将关键词、网页标题、URL等信息进行索引,以便用户查询时可以快速定位到相关的网页。
-
数据存储:手机搜索引擎数据库一般使用分布式存储系统来存储大量的数据。分布式存储系统可以将数据分散存储在多台服务器上,提高数据的存储容量和访问速度。
-
数据更新:互联网上的网页内容是动态变化的,因此搜索引擎数据库需要定期更新数据,保持数据的最新性。更新数据的方式一般是通过定时的爬虫程序重新抓取网页内容,并将新的数据与旧的数据进行对比,更新数据库中的数据。
以上是手机搜索引擎数据库的基本构建和维护过程。通过合理的设计和优化,可以提高搜索引擎的搜索速度和准确性,为用户提供更好的搜索体验。
1年前 -